  8. ಅಕ್ಕಸಾಲೆ

    Play audio
    ♪ akkasāle
    Share screenshot
    1. (Noun)
    2. one who works in gold or silver; goldsmith; silversmith.
    3. the caste of goldsmiths, one of the notified backward castes.
    4. a room, building where a goldsmith carries out his profession; goldsmith's workshop;
    5. ಅಕ್ಕಸಾಲೆ ಕಿವಿ ಚುಚ್ಚಿದರೆ ನೋವಿಲ್ಲ akkasāle kivi cuccidare nōvilla (prov.) the kick of the dam hurts not the colt; ಅಕ್ಕಸಾಲೆಗಿಂತ ಕಳ್ಳನಿಲ್ಲ, ಮಕ್ಕಿ ಗದ್ದೆಗಿಂತ ಬೆಳೆಯಿಲ್ಲ akkasāleginta kaḷḷanilla, makki gaddeginta beḷeyilla (prov.) = ಅಕ್ಕನ ಬಂಗಾರವಾದರೂ ಅಕ್ಕಸಾಲೆ ಬಿಡ; ಅಕ್ಕನ ಬಂಗಾರವಾದರೂ ಅಕ್ಕಸಾಲೆ ಬಿಡ akkana baŋgāravādarū akkasāle biḍa (prov.) a thief steals from his nearest persons too.
